Output 44ca03e94b87800595b78fcbe005bd1379ede4d80a6ae148bd30413980ec9000:1

value
15580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86687e57125203a296cc9701df73e428349a1043 OP_EQUAL
address
3DwheavvVGKGAC47tVQAV4LKkdiML4W2SB
transaction
44ca03e94b87800595b78fcbe005bd1379ede4d80a6ae148bd30413980ec9000
spent
true